当前位置:首页 > 问答 > 正文

私有云听起来简单,实际操作和维护远比想象中复杂多了

(信息来源于多位IT从业者在专业社区如知乎、CSDN上的经验分享帖,以及部分科技媒体对中小企业数字化转型困难的报道综述)

私有云听起来简单,实际操作和维护远比想象中复杂多了,很多人一开始的想法可能跟我当初一样,觉得不就是买几台好点的服务器,装上虚拟化软件,然后把公司的各种应用系统往里一放嘛,这样数据在自己机房,安全又可控,好像就万事大吉了,但真正动手做起来,才会发现每一步都藏着意想不到的坑。

最开始的规划和设计就让人头疼,这不像去买个现成的软件,付了钱就能用,你得先想清楚,公司到底有多少个部门、多少个业务系统需要放上去?每个系统现在需要多少计算能力、多大内存、多少存储空间?这还不够,你还得预测未来一两年业务可能会增长多少,得留出足够的余量,不然业务一发展,云平台就先撑不住了,到时候再扩容又是麻烦事,但余量留多了呢,昂贵的服务器资源又白白闲置在那里浪费钱,这个平衡点非常难找,有篇文章里提到(源自某位IT项目经理在博客中的自述),他们为了确定初始采购规模,光是和各个业务部门开会沟通需求就花了将近一个月,最后出来的方案还是被老板质疑成本太高。

私有云听起来简单,实际操作和维护远比想象中复杂多了

硬件买回来,只是万里长征第一步,接下来的软件部署和配置更是技术活,虽然市面上有一些开源的或者商业的私有云软件,号称能简化管理,但真到安装的时候,各种依赖关系、网络配置、存储配置问题层出不穷,我记得有个工程师在论坛上吐槽(根据知乎相关话题下的高赞回答整理),他们团队三个人折腾了一个星期,才勉强把基础平台搭起来,期间遇到了无数次安装失败,日志文件看得人头昏眼花,却常常找不到问题的明确原因,这需要运维人员不仅有扎实的Linux系统功底,还要对网络、存储都有很深的理解,这种复合型人才本身就不好找,成本也高。

平台好不容易搭起来了,以为可以松口气了,但其实最艰巨的任务——日常运维——才刚刚开始,私有云它不是搭好就一劳永逸的,它是个活的、需要持续照看的“孩子”,硬件是会出故障的,普通的服务器,坏了一块硬盘、一根内存条,可能只影响一两个应用,但在私有云环境里,所有的应用都跑在虚拟机上,而虚拟机又依赖于底层共享的物理资源,一旦某台物理服务器出严重故障,上面跑着的十几个甚至几十个虚拟机可能全部瘫痪,导致大面积的业务中断,这就要求私有云必须具备高可用性机制,比如要做集群,要配置共享存储,要实现故障自动迁移,这些配置本身又极其复杂,任何一个环节设置不当,高可用就成了摆设。

私有云听起来简单,实际操作和维护远比想象中复杂多了

软件层面的维护同样不省心,虚拟化平台本身、操作系统、中间件,还有上面跑的各种应用,都需要定期打补丁、升级版本,以修复安全漏洞和提升性能,这个打补丁的过程在私有云里变得异常棘手,你不能像对待单台机器那样直接重启,因为一台物理主机上托管着多台虚拟机,你需要有计划地先将虚拟机迁移到其他主机上,然后给空闲下来的主机打补丁、重启,再迁移回来,循环操作,这个过程非常耗时,而且风险很高,万一迁移过程中出现网络闪断或者兼容性问题,就可能导致服务不可用,有报道曾引用过一位运维负责人的话(摘自某科技媒体对中小企业IT困境的采访),“每次规划系统升级都像是一次大考,精神高度紧张,生怕哪个操作失误导致全线崩溃。”

安全问题是另一个重担,数据放在自己家里,理论上更安全,但前提是你得有足够的能力来保护这个“家”,你需要建立防火墙、入侵检测系统、严格的访问控制策略,还要应对层出不穷的网络攻击,这些安全设备和策略的配置管理,需要专业的安全运维人员,对中小企业来说,又是一笔不小的人力成本,否则,私有云很可能成为一个安全短板,反而比使用经过严格安全审计的公有云风险更高。

成本问题往往被严重低估,很多人只算了最初的硬件和软件采购成本,但后续的电力消耗、机房空间、制冷费用是持续的,更重要的是人力成本,要维持一个私有云平台7x24小时稳定运行,至少需要一个几人组成的运维团队,这些资深IT工程师的薪水是非常可观的,算下来总拥有成本可能远超预期,很多企业最后发现,看似“免费”或“一次性投入”的私有云,长期来看比使用公有云要昂贵得多,而且还得自己承担所有的运维压力和风险。

私有云绝不是一个简单的技术产品,它更像是一个持续性的IT服务和治理项目,它要求企业具备强大的技术团队、规范的流程和充足的预算,对于那些IT力量相对薄弱的中小企业来说,盲目上马私有云,很可能陷入“建不好、用不顺、管不了”的尴尬境地,最终反而拖累了业务的发展,这也就是为什么很多有过亲身经历的人会感叹,私有云这东西,想起来很美,做起来真难。